Former Seahawk Richard Sherman reveals counseling, medication after July arrest

Former Seattle Seahawk star Richard Sherman, who hit a rough legal patch over the summer, is heading east.

“I’m going to go play for the Tampa Bay Buccaneers, Woo!”

The five time all-pro cornerback was all smiles as he made the announcement on YouTube Wednesday.

Richard Sherman signed a one year deal with the Buccaneers, although he says other teams, including the Seahawks, expressed interest. That despite challenges over the summer.

“Obviously, mentally, I had my moments,” Sherman said in the video.
